Marilyn vos Savant is a writer and member of Mensa.
History[edit]
When Seymour Skinner welcomed Lisa to Mensa he told her that she would join such Mensa luminaries as Marilyn vos Savant, Geena Davis, and Mell Lazarus, each of whom stands at the top of their respective fields. Professor Frink then pointed Mell Lazarus out as an exception.
